汇编语言是一种
-
前段时间把C项目融入到安卓里,最近又要把C项目转成JavaScript,真的是C通万语,啥都能用C,不过从C转换到别的语言要学习不同的工具,是不是会一个C,啥项目都能搞。。。...
作者:wangerxian回复:27
-
单片机的主流编程语言是汇编语言和C语言。 单片机的c语言是一种编译型程序设计语言,它兼顾了多种高级语言的特点,并具备汇编语言的功能。...
作者:huaqingyuanjian回复:13
-
以上两种方式都不能使用时,但我们还想在线调试、只能用最后一种方式,局部函数的优化等级调整,如果再不行那么可以考虑换芯片了。。。...
作者:EEWORLD社区回复:107
-
单片机(Microcontroller)和工控机(Industrial PC)是两种用途和应用场景不同的计算设备,它们有以下主要区别: 用途和应用场景: 单片机: 是一种集成了处理器核心...
作者:qxdl12345回复:0
-
正确的做法是确保索引`i`在分配的数组长度内。 #### 解决方法 - **硬件相关的问题**:采取恰当的散热措施,使用稳定的电源供应,并且定期检查硬件的完整性。...
作者:segFault回复:2
-
一、什么是中断?为什么要有中断 ? 在Linux内核中,中断是一种硬件机制,用于在处理器与设备之间传递异步事件的信号。...
作者:硬核王同学回复:1
-
在汇编语言中,像BL、B、MOV指令属于位置无关指令,不 管程序装载在哪个位置,它们都能正确地运行,它们的地址域是基于PC值的相对偏移寻址,相当于 。...
作者:nmg回复:9
-
至于线程,它和进程,是一种包含关系,而线程和进程最大最大的根本区别,也就是, 进程拥有自己的独立的运行状态(用一组寄存器数据来保存),以及相应的其他资源,例如内存等; 而线程......
作者:辛昕回复:9
-
求助各位大神,初学者,正在看汇编语言,开始接难住了, 机器语言二进制数与十进制十六进制到底是什么关系,怎么转换,十六进制有什么优势,为什么都是用十六进制数表示,数据传输与储存不都是二进制数吗 求助各位大神...
作者:haocede回复:12
-
3.Cortex-M0的另一种重要应用为专用标准电路(ASSP)和片上系统(SoC)。...
作者:cmmjava回复:1
-
什么是原子操作呢?原子操作是指 保证指令以原子的方式执行,执行过程不会被打断。 名词解释总是如此地晦涩难懂! 咱们的处理器工作都是以 加载-执行 的模式运行。...
作者:jobszheng5回复:7
-
看解析,逗号分隔符和 tab制表符都是分隔符的一种呀~ 有些按长度解析,高八位低八位,0110写一串也行~ 谢谢,我查了一下,规定是这样的: 分界符(分隔符) 汇编程序在上述每段的开头或末尾使用分隔符把各段分开...
作者:一沙一世回复:11
-
有了这个基础再去学习其他单片机那就是小菜一碟了,只是对着芯片数据手册设置寄存器罢了,快则一两个星期,多则一个月就能掌握另一种单片机。...
作者:huaqingyuanjian回复:5
-
汇编语言是各种CPU提供的机器指令的助记符的集合,人们可以用汇编语言直接控制硬件系统进行工作。汇编语言是很多相关课程(如数据结构、操作系统、微机原理等)的重要基础。...
作者:arui1999回复:6
-
这种错误发生的概率非常小,你的定时中断每秒一次,定时中断修改某个变量,而且正好是为这个变量赋值时,才会发生错误。所以,这种错误运行几次几十次几百次几千次程序也不一定发生,很难检查出来。...
作者:一沙一世回复:9
-
硬件验证语言 简介 硬件验证语言 (HVL) 是一种编程语言,用于验证以硬件描述语言 (HDL) 编写的电子电路设计。...
作者:modemdesign回复:1
-
GD32官网上提供了现成的Pack,因此使用第一种方法进行安装。安装完成之后显示为下图的状态。 工程的创建 工程的创建使用GD32提供的模板工程。...
作者:xiaoli2018回复:2
-
C语言它是一门更偏向于底层的语言,我个人感觉学好了C语言真的是其他语言都不在话下的,其他语言像java、C++、python只是不同的语法规则而已。那C语言对于初学者需要掌握哪些技能呢?...
作者:cdhqyj回复:3
-
本文设计了一种物联网的水温控制系统,包括机智云 物联网平台 ,DS18B20水温传感器、水温主控制器和通信模块STC单片机、 esp8266 无线模块等。...
作者:毛球大大回复:2
-
第二章 RV32I:RISC-V 基础整数指令集 第三章 RISC-V 汇编语言 第四章 乘法和除法指令 第五章 RV32F 和 RV32D:单精度和双精度浮点数 第六章 原子指令 第七章 压缩指令...
作者:蓝猫淘气回复:89